【发布时间】:2013-01-31 14:47:40
【问题描述】:
我知道always_return_data = True 在创建之后会返回一个对象。
我想在创建对象时返回一个数据列表。
(当用户like 发布帖子时,我会返回帖子的所有点赞信息)
这是一种不好的做法吗?
我可以在常规的 django 视图中轻松地做到这一点,但很难吃到美味的馅饼。
【问题讨论】:
我知道always_return_data = True 在创建之后会返回一个对象。
我想在创建对象时返回一个数据列表。
(当用户like 发布帖子时,我会返回帖子的所有点赞信息)
这是一种不好的做法吗?
我可以在常规的 django 视图中轻松地做到这一点,但很难吃到美味的馅饼。
【问题讨论】:
我唯一能想到的就是为 Resource/ModelResource 创建一个 Mixin 和一个不同的 post_list/put_detail/put_list 来处理这个问题。查看resources.py 了解您需要更改的功能。
【讨论】: